SPOTLIGHT ON COASTAL CORRUPTION v. KINSEY

No. D074673.

57 Cal.App.5th 874 (2020)

271 Cal. Rptr. 3d 867

SPOTLIGHT ON COASTAL CORRUPTION, Plaintiff and Respondent, v. STEVE KINSEY et al., Defendants and Appellants.

Court of Appeals of California, Fourth District, Division One.

November 24, 2020.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Xavier Becerra , Attorney General, Daniel A. Olivas , Assistant Attorney General, David G. Alderson and Joel S. Jacobs , Deputy Attorneys General, for Defendants and Appellants.

Briggs Law Corporation, Corey J. Briggs ; Higgs Fletcher & Mack, John Morris and Rachel E. Moffitt for Plaintiff and Respondent.


OPINION

Defendants, who at the time of trial were current or former California Coastal Commissioners (Commissioners), appeal from a nearly $1 million judgment after the court found they violated statutes requiring disclosure of certain ex parte communications.
